Dear Gents

I am from riyadh. by end this month, i want to go abu dhabi by road with family. For that, i want applying visa for my wife and son.For WIFE and SON, What profession i have to select under GCC Residents while i am selecting Abu Dhabi and ALGOUIFAT. Becuz HOUSE WIFE,STUDENT is not showing.



Can some one guide me?

See also

Iqama visa in Saudi ArabiaVisas in Saudi ArabiaVisa for my sonQVP processing timeQVP and SCE Process Time
TheLegendLeads

To apply visa for yourself: From the left menu click the top most option:  GCC Residents
For your wife and kids, use the second link named 'GCC Citizen - Accompanies'

By the way, in both forms there are professions of HOUSE WIFE and STUDENT/NOT ALLOWED TO WORK
